WebIpk= V*Ton/L. For example,assuming zero initial current, if a 1mH inductor has 10V applied for 1ms, then after 1 ms the current will be: Ipk= 10V*1ms/1mH= 10A, So we can see current can quickly climb in a typical inductor.
